Liceo Signs Memorandum of Agreement with Life Project for Youth

   The Liceo de Cagayan University entered  into an agreement with the Life Project for Youth which is an international organization founded in the Philippines. The Life Project for Youth (LP4Y) is a non-government organization located at Our Lady of Mount Carmel Church, Barangay Carmen, Cagayan de Oro City. Its mission is to socially and professionally integrate the excluded youth of Cagayan de Oro. The LP4Y Alliance is a group of autonomous humanitarian organizations sharing LP4Y's project. They are located not just in the Philippines, but also in Vietnam, Indonesia, India, Belgium, the United States of America, France and Luxembourg. The LP4Y Alliance brings together those who wish to work for the integration of excluded youth and it seeks to find an institution to help their youth in terms of English Proficiency and Computer Literacy. Thus, Liceo de Cagayan University was chosen as their partner to deliver the services they needed. As a partner, the university will provide trainers to conduct the English Proficiency and Computer Literacy programs.

 

   Dr. Lesley C. Lubos, Vice President for Research, Publication, and Extension, led the signing of the memorandum of agreement last May 24, 2017 at NAC203, together with Dr. Felsa A. Labis, Director for Liceo Center for Community Development, Mrs. Prenelei P. Vaquez, Assistant Director for Liceo Center for Community Development, Mr. Marco Rado, Faculty of the College of Information Technology, and Mr. Ramon A. Abrera Jr., OIC Dean of the College of Arts and Sciences. The representatives of the project were Mr. Alexandre Nicolet and Ms. Maïlys Nicolet, the Coaches of the Life Project for Youth, and the 12 youths from LP4Y. After the program, the LP4Y Youth together with their coaches toured Liceo U campus and visited the classrooms, Computer Laboratories, and the Speech Enhancement Center.
